Understanding Best Buy's Appointment System

Best Buy uses an appointment system that lets customers schedule specific times to visit their stores for various services. This system helps manage customer flow and reduces wait times for services like tech support, device setup, product consultations, and repairs through their Geek Squad service. The appointment booking process exists to help both customers and staff coordinate their time more efficiently.

The appointment system operates across Best Buy's network of physical locations. When you schedule an appointment, you're reserving a specific time slot with a technician or associate who can address your needs. This differs from walk-in service, where you might wait an unpredictable amount of time depending on how busy the store is that day.

Best Buy offers appointments for several types of services. Geek Squad appointments cover computer repair, phone repair, TV installation, home theater setup, and data transfer services. In-store consultations let you meet with staff about purchasing decisions for cameras, laptops, audio equipment, and other products. Some locations also offer appointment slots for services like trade-in evaluations or product setup at home.

Understanding what types of appointments Best Buy offers at your location is the first step. Different stores have different service capabilities based on their size and staffing. A smaller Best Buy may not offer all services, while larger locations provide more options. Knowing which services are available helps you determine what you need before you begin booking.

Practical Takeaway: Visit your nearest Best Buy's website or call their store directly to learn which appointment services they currently offer. This prevents wasting time trying to book something unavailable at your location.

Creating or Accessing Your Best Buy Account

To book an appointment online through Best Buy's website, you'll need either an existing account or the ability to create one. Best Buy accounts are free and store information like your email address, phone number, and payment methods for online shopping. You don't need to have made previous purchases at Best Buy to create an account.

If you already shop at Best Buy, you likely have an account. You can log in using your email address and password. If you've forgotten your password, Best Buy's website has a password recovery option where you enter your email and follow the instructions sent to you. This typically takes a few minutes.

Creating a new account is straightforward. On Best Buy's website, look for a "Sign Up" or "Create Account" option, usually found near the login area. You'll need to provide your email address, create a password, and enter your name and zip code. Best Buy may also ask for your phone number. The account creation process usually takes less than five minutes.

Your account doesn't require you to link a credit card or provide payment information unless you're making a purchase. For appointment booking, you only need basic contact information. This information helps Best Buy contact you if there are changes to your appointment or if staff need to reach you on the day of your visit.

Some customers prefer to book appointments by phone rather than online. If you choose this route, you don't need an account. You can call your local Best Buy store directly, and a staff member will collect your information and schedule your appointment. This method works well if you prefer speaking to someone directly or have questions about the appointment process.

Practical Takeaway: Whether you use online or phone booking, gather your contact information beforehand—email, phone number, and zip code. This makes the booking process faster regardless of which method you choose.

Navigating the Online Booking Process

Best Buy's online appointment booking process happens through their website or mobile app. Once you're logged into your account, look for an appointments section, often found in your account menu or on the main website. The layout may vary depending on whether you're using a computer, phone, or tablet, but the basic steps remain similar.

After accessing the appointments area, you'll typically select your location first. Best Buy will either detect your nearby stores or let you enter a zip code to find locations near you. Once you choose a store, the system shows which services that location offers and displays available appointment times.

Next, you'll select the type of service you need. Options might include Geek Squad repair services, in-store consultations, device setup, or other available services. Choosing the correct service category is important because it determines which staff members are scheduled for your appointment and how long the appointment slot will be.

After selecting your service, you'll see available dates and times. These options change based on current demand and staff availability. If you don't see times that work for you, check back later—stores often open new appointment slots throughout the week. The system typically shows appointments available anywhere from a few days to several weeks in advance.

You'll then enter details about what you need help with. For example, if booking a Geek Squad appointment, you might specify whether you're bringing a laptop, phone, or other device. Describe the issue or service needed in the space provided. This information helps the technician prepare and can sometimes reduce your appointment time.

After reviewing all your information, you'll confirm the appointment. Best Buy typically sends a confirmation email with your appointment details, including the date, time, store location, and service description. Save this confirmation or print it for your records.

Practical Takeaway: Before starting the booking process, decide which service you need and identify your preferred store location. Knowing these details prevents confusion during booking and helps you complete the process more quickly.

Timing Your Appointment and Planning Ahead

Appointment availability varies significantly based on the day of the week and time of day. Weekday mornings and early afternoons typically have more open slots than evenings and weekends. If your schedule is flexible, booking a weekday appointment may give you more options to choose from and potentially shorter wait times if something runs behind.

Consider how much time you should allocate for your appointment. Simple services like a product consultation might take 30 minutes, while Geek Squad repairs for complex issues can take two to four hours or longer. The appointment time slot typically reflects the expected duration. If you're dropping off a device for repair, you may not need to stay the entire time, though staff will give you an estimated return date when you drop it off.

Plan to arrive 10 to 15 minutes before your scheduled appointment time. This gives you time to find parking, locate the service area in the store, and check in with staff. Arriving early also prevents you from being late if you encounter unexpected traffic or parking difficulties.

Bring any relevant items or documentation to your appointment. If you're bringing a device for repair, bring it along with any cables or accessories. If you have a warranty or protection plan, bring the documentation. For consultations about purchases, bring any questions or specifications you've written down. Having these items ready prevents delays during your appointment.

If your circumstances change and you can no longer make your appointment, cancel it through your account or by calling the store. Canceling ahead of time opens the slot for another customer and helps the store manage their schedule. Best Buy's cancellation policy typically allows cancellations up to 24 hours before your appointment time.

Practical Takeaway: Choose a time that fits your schedule comfortably, arrive 10 to 15 minutes early, and gather any materials you'll need before your appointment date. This preparation sets you up for a smooth experience.

Preparing for Different Types of Appointments

The preparation steps vary depending on what service you're getting. For Geek Squad repair appointments, back up important data on your device before bringing it in if possible. If you can't back up the data yourself, mention this during your appointment—technicians can help, though it may affect timing and costs. Write down any problems you've noticed so you can describe them clearly to the technician.

For in-store product consultations, think about what you're looking to purchase and what matters most to you. Are you prioritizing price, performance, specific features, or brand? Write down your budget and any must-have specifications. This helps the staff member provide relevant recommendations rather than guessing at what you need. If you've already researched products online, it's fine to mention that—staff can answer follow-up questions or explain differences between options.

For device setup appointments, whether at the store or in your home, clear a space where the technician can work. If it's a home appointment like TV installation or audio setup, ensure the technician can reach the installation area safely. Remove obstacles and have any required cables or accessories ready.
